Jogging around Sassegnies offers access to a rural landscape characterized by open spaces and natural features. The commune is situated in the Nord department of France, featuring the Sambre canalized waterway which provides flat and scenic routes along its banks. Proximity to the Mormal Forest suggests opportunities for running through wooded areas, while historical pastures and woodlands contribute to a diverse environment for outdoor exercise. This setting provides varied terrain suitable for different jogging preferences.

Sassegnies offers a wide variety of running opportunities, with over 200 routes available on komoot. These routes cater to different preferences, ranging from easy paths to more challenging trails.
The jogging routes in Sassegnies feature diverse terrain. You can expect flat and scenic paths along the Sambre canalized waterway, as well as routes through wooded areas due to its proximity to the Mormal Forest. The historical landscape of pastures and woodlands also contributes to a varied and enjoyable running experience.
Yes, Sassegnies has 19 easy running routes perfect for beginners or those looking for a relaxed jog. These paths allow you to enjoy the rural scenery without significant elevation changes.
For more experienced runners seeking a challenge, Sassegnies offers 36 difficult running trails. These routes often feature more varied terrain and longer distances, providing a substantial workout.
The running trails in Sassegnies are highly regarded by the komoot community, holding an average rating of 4.5 stars from over 30 reviews. More than 3000 runners have explored the area, often praising its tranquil rural setting and diverse natural features.
Yes, many of the running routes in Sassegnies are circular,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. For example, the Carrefour du Croisil loop from Sassegnies is a popular moderate 10.1 km circular path that explores the rural surroundings.
While specific 'family-friendly' designations aren't always explicit, the presence of numerous easy and moderate routes, particularly those along the flat Sambre canal, makes many trails suitable for families. The La Cressonnière loop from Leval, a 7.0 km moderate trail, could be a good option for a family outing.
While jogging in Sassegnies, you'll encounter the scenic Sambre canalized waterway and enjoy views of extensive pastures and woodlands. Nearby attractions include the historic Grand Fayt Mill and the Weir at L'Auberge du Puits des Prés, offering interesting sights along your run.

Sassegnies offers enjoyable running conditions throughout much of the year. Spring and autumn provide pleasant temperatures and beautiful scenery with changing foliage. Summer is also great, especially for runs along the shaded paths of the Mormal Forest or the open canal banks. Winter running is possible, but check local weather conditions for ice or snow.
Yes, Sassegnies provides several longer routes suitable for endurance training. The Carrefour du Croisil loop from Berlaimont Le Sars Bara Place is a substantial 10.8 km (6.7 miles) moderate trail, offering a good distance for a satisfying long run.
Absolutely! The region around Sassegnies is rich in natural beauty and historical sites. You can plan your run to pass by highlights such as the Watermill in Parc Naturel Régional de l'Avesnois or the Chemin Planté forest road, adding an exploratory element to your exercise.
